Best 16830 Pennsylvania Private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 3 private schools serving 349 students in 16830, PA (there are 3 public schools, serving 2,075 public students). 14% of all K-12 students in 16830, PA are educated in private schools (compared to the PA state average of 14%).
The average acceptance rate is 95%, which is higher than the Pennsylvania private school average acceptance rate of 81%.
67% of private schools in 16830, PA are religiously affiliated (most commonly Christian and Catholic).
